Bayern goodbye for Lizarazu

Bixente Lizarazu will leave FC Bayern München at the end of the season after failing to agree a new contract.

Impressive record
Lizarazu joined Bayern in 1997 from Athletic Club Bilbao and has been a key figure at the Olympiastadion ever since. The 34-year-old helped the club win Bundesliga titles in 1998/99, 1999/00, 2000/01 and 2002/03 as well as German Cups in 1997/98, 1999/00 and 2002/03. He was also in the team that won the UEFA Champions League in 2001.

However, the left-back has decided to move on in the summer after contract talks failed to reach a satisfactory conclusion. "I have decided to leave Bayern when my contract is up in the summer," he said. "I am very proud of what I have achieved here because I won every important title available. I now hope to help another club with my experience."

'Sad to see him go'
Bayern coach Ottmar Hitzfeld said he would have liked to have kept Lizarazu for at least another year, but had to admit defeat. "We are very sad to see him go because he is a true professional," said Hitzfeld.
